Title :
The Efficient DBA Algorithm with Multi-Threshold Reporting in EPON

Abstract :
To improve the uplink bandwidth utility, an efficient DBA (EM-DBA) with multi-threshold reporting is presented. The excessive bandwidth in each polling-grant circle is divided into private one only for certain ONU and the public one for all ONUs to calculate the appropriate multi-threshold values which could reduce the unused timeslots greatly. Accumulating the left excessive bandwidth for the latter circles would increase the total available bandwidth in one circle for strengthening the ability to resist the variance of traffic. The simulation result shows that the throughput, end-to-end delay, bandwidth waste are improved compared with the reference algorithms.
